RNA interference (RNAi) is the most recent discovery to revolutionize the study of biology. In this book, leaders in the field contribute state-of-the-art, easy to follow methods and bench protocols designed for practical, everyday use of RNAi in biological research. Cutting edge and clearly written, this book enables a researcher with standard molecular biological training to perform major RNAi-related experiments and contribute to this revolutionary, growing field.
